Abstract

Experimental project to investigate defects, defect properties, defect processes, and the evolution of nanostructures and phase transformations in ceramics under ion irradiation. The work primarily involves studies of single crystals where the defects induced by ion irradiaton are characterized in situ using ion-beam analysis methods, or ex situ using electron microscopy and X-ray diffraction. The goal is to develop a fundamental understanding of defects and dynamic defect processes in complex ceramic structures, including defect/property relationships, the effects of defects on transport processes and solid-state phase transformations, and the aggregation of defects to form complex nanostructures.
